As a follower of Jesus, it can be difficult sometimes to explain why we believe what we believe. Even if we know what’s true when it comes to our faith, putting words around it isn’t always easy. That’s where Scripture can help! It helps us better understand what we believe and gives us words to share it with others!
This week, make memorizing this verse the goal. And, of course, make it fun! Grab some of your favorite candy—a piece for each word in this verse. Write the verse down and place a piece of candy over each word. Then, see how many of the words you know! Each time you get a word right, you get to eat the piece of candy covering it!

About this Plan

Remembering the things Jesus said that we never want to forget. A middle school devotional designed to help students focus on the person of Jesus this Easter season. In this devotional, you'll find a focus on the love of God demonstrated through the life, death, and resurrection of Jesus that we remember every year at Easter.
